Understanding your target audience is the backbone of any successful marketing strategy. It's like trying to hit a bullseye blindfolded - you might get lucky once or twice, but without knowing where you're aiming, your efforts will be largely inefficient and expensive. So, how do you remove the blindfold and get to know your audience?
Start with your current customer base. Ask yourself: who are they? What needs are you fulfilling for them? What do they value about your product or service? The answers to these questions can help you develop a profile of your ideal customer. This is not about excluding potential customers, but rather about focusing your marketing efforts on those who are most likely to engage with your business.
Once you have a basic understanding of your ideal customer, you can create more detailed buyer personas. These are fictional representations of your customers, providing you with a clearer picture of who you're targeting. For example, a bicycle retailer might have a persona like Ashley: a 28-year-old urban professional who loves biking on weekends and spends around $5,000 a year on bikes and accessories. By creating these personas, you can tailor your marketing strategies to meet the specific needs and interests of your target audience, improving the efficiency of your lead generation efforts.

Local lead generation is a key component of any business's growth strategy, and social media platforms play a pivotal role in this process. By utilizing plat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and LinkedIn, you can engage with potential customers and generate sales leads. Your social media profile serves as a beacon for your brand, attracting new followers and potential clients.
Local SEO is another powerful tool that can enhance your business's visibility in your area. It increases web traffic, improves conversion rates, and reduces advertising costs. With 46% of all Google searches seeking local information, optimizing your local SEO can lead to a significant boost in sales.
Ensure your social media profiles and posts are optimized with relevant keywords and hashtags.
Promote great content to attract new followers and generate leads.
Invest in targeted ads to get your business in front of potential customers.
Utilize local SEO strategies, like backlinking to local events sites and using location-specific phrases in keywords.
By integrating social media and local SEO into your marketing strategy, you can boost your brand's online presence and generate more leads in your local area.
Building trust with potential local customers is not just a nice-to-have, it's a must-have. With the 2018 Edelman Trust Barometer revealing that only 48 percent of the general population trusts businesses, it's critical for businesses to step up their game.
Here are a few proven techniques:
Active Community Participation: Engage in local events and festivals, collaborate with other local businesses, and establish a strong online presence. Remember, word-of-mouth is a powerful tool, especially for local businesses.
Top-Notch Customer Service: Exceptional customer service demonstrates a commitment to customer interests and shows that your company genuinely cares about its customers.
Share Positive Reviews: Consumers trust their fellow customers. Showcase positive reviews and testimonials to boost your credibility.
Honest Marketing: Be transparent and ethical in all your dealings. Misleading marketing can cause severe damage to your reputation.

One of the most crucial steps in your local lead generation business is tracking and evaluating your success. This will not only help you know what's working but also spot areas that require improvement.
Utilize Tools: There are many tools available to help you track your progress. Some of these tools include Google Analytics for website traffic, social media analytics for engagement, and email tracking for email deliverability.
Key Metrics: Key metrics that can help you measure the success of your lead generation efforts include number of new leads, conversion rates, and customer acquisition costs.
Data Analysis: Use the collected data to analyze your strategies. Spot trends, identify successful techniques, and learn from your failures. This will help you refine your strategies and generate even more leads.
